What it is
The product in plain English
A crypto spending card with a published cashback range and strict regional limitations.
Best fit, not a ranking: Eligible non-EEA users who want a Bybit-linked payment card and are comfortable checking current reward terms.
Money movement
How the card is funded
Bybit describes flexible crypto-or-cash spending through its platform; the exact supported assets and top-up method depend on the eligible regional product.
Rewards: Bybit advertises 2%–10% cashback on everyday spending and a welcome package with up to 110 USDT cashback in the first 30 days; terms and eligible categories apply.
Cost reality
Read beyond the headline
Bybit’s card page does not publish one universal fee table in the visible overview; card, conversion, ATM, and regional fees should be checked in the application flow and terms.
Caution: The Bybit page explicitly excludes EEA customers. Cashback, fees, merchant categories, and eligibility are not universal and may change.

Before you apply
Five checks that prevent bad comparisons
01
Country
Confirm the product is actually available at your address.
02
Funding
Know whether you spend cash, converted crypto, or borrowed value.
03
Fees
Look for spreads, FX, ATM, top-up, and subscription charges.
04
Issuer
The brand on the card may not be the legal issuer.
05
Tax
Spending crypto can create tax consequences in some jurisdictions.
